- The distribution rate is calculated by annualizing the last distribution and then dividing by the period-ending NAV or market price.
- The Wells Fargo Utilities and High Income Fund is a closed-end equity and high-yield bond fund.
- Wells Fargo Asset Management (WFAM) is the trade name for certain investment advisory/management firms owned by Wells Fargo & Company.
